Research – ‘Mixed-mode’ Ventilation in Building Design – Research with UC Berkeley’s Center for the Built Environment – 2005

Research – ‘Mixed-mode’ Ventilation in Building Design – Research with UC Berkeley’s Center for the Built Environment – 2005

Why is it important to use natural ventilation in building design? The added oxygen content keeps occupants more awake. Natural ventilation can carry pleasant smells from outside. And the experience of air movement from the exterior is a reminder of the larger world around us.
